

i-Switch Prepaid Metering (Pty) Ltd
Based on recent customer reviews, i-Switch Prepaid Metering (Pty) Ltd receives strong praise for individual staff members, particularly Nathanie Chellan, Lee-Shane Titus, Lee-Ann, and Harold, who are consistently highlighted for prompt, professional, and after-hours assistance. However, a significant portion of negative feedback centres on billing errors, unexplained high charges, lump-sum deductions from meter reading failures, and prolonged electricity disconnections while disputes remain unresolved. Customers also express frustration with the app's reliability, lack of transparency in consumption data, and the perceived high cost of fixed daily charges.

I so wish there was a minus rating because that's what i-Switch Prepared Metering deserves. I have been buying electricity units and everything has been fine. From time to time I would run out of units and they would switch off the electricity, which is understandable but the balance has never reached more that minus R100 if I'm not mistaken. However, today my electricity went off and when I checked my balance, its on minus R952 which is something that has never happened. i-Switch's explanation is that the meter has not been billing since beginning of October 2025 and that this error caused the balance reading to be inaccurate, showing a positive balance even when the balance was negative. My problem is that I have been fulfilling my responsibility of buying electricity, and i-Switch on their side failed to fix their error since October and I was never notified of this error, I kept on buying and using electricity without the knowledge of any errors which i-Switch is now claiming on the 7th of January, three months after they discovered the claimed billing errors. i-Switch is making their failure and incompetence my problem whereby I have to now pay R952 before they switch on my electricity, the R952 which i knew nothing about while on their side they had knowledge of this for three months and did nothing about it. Tell me how this is fair to a customer that has been buying electricity.
